Carriers and services on this route
Three carriers cover this route. DHL provides the fastest air service via its European hub network connecting to Yerevan. FedEx connects through Istanbul or Frankfurt hubs with reliable express delivery. Haypost (HayPost CJSC) is the national Armenian postal operator providing the widest last-mile coverage across all regions including rural areas and mountain villages.

Delivery times in detail
Transit times are in business days from pickup in Spain to delivery in Armenia. EAEU customs declaration is mandatory on all international shipments. Parcels fly to Zvartnots Airport (EVN), 12 km west of central Yerevan. Express services reach Yerevan in 7-9 days; economy services in 11-14 days. Deliveries to Gyumri (second-largest city) and Vanadzor typically add 1-2 days.
How to pack your parcel for this route
Use double-wall boxes for this route: parcels transit via European hubs before continuing to Yerevan. Wrap fragile items with 3 cm of bubble wrap. Armenia's mountainous terrain means last-mile delivery can involve additional handling.
Practical tips for this route
Two route-specific points. First, Armenia is part of the EAEU customs union, which sets a personal import de minimis of 200 EUR per shipment and 1,000 EUR per year (calendar year). Shipments valued under 200 EUR and weighing under 31 kg enter duty-free for personal use. Above 200 EUR, the EAEU charges 15% customs duty plus 20% VAT on the amount exceeding the threshold. Second, Armenian postal codes are 4 digits, ranging from 0001 to 4404. Yerevan districts start from 0001 (Kentron) to 0082. Always include the 4-digit code and the correct Yerevan district name - Haypost routing relies on both the code and the district name, not just the street address.
